Chapter 204

ARES

I set the glass down, took another cigar, and shoved it between my lips, using the Zippo to light the bottom.

I ran a hand through my hair as I told a drag, letting the smoke release from my nostrils.

When I clutched the bottle to pour myself another drink, I heard the snappy sound of click-clack, and a hand took the bottle and tossed it, smashing noise filling the air.

“Idiot! You rented out a full bar to drown yourself in alcohol p>

I took the cigar off my lips, pressing the bottom into the ashtray filled with many others.

“Let’s talk about Cat p>

I snapped my eyes to Athena. She was angry, and she rarely showed it because she didn’t like negative emotions.

“Damn that habit of yours! Catherine was meant to be different. Do you wanna ruin that? Tell me p>

“This is none of your business p>

“So what? You’re gonna let Cat go p>

A squeeze found my chest, but I disregarded it and sipped from my glass. “Yes p>

“I don’t believe you p>

“You don’t need to p>

“Why are you doing this p>

“She broke the rule in the special clause p>

“Let me guess, she’s in love with you p>

I pinned her with my cold eyes, but Athena wasn’t affected.

“Is she wrong?” she asked more softly.

I didn’t reply. I heard her pull out the chair to sit, taking my glass before it could get to my lips. She finished it in one go, grimacing at the burn.

“A day ago, you risked everything to get her back, but now, you’re just gonna let her go p>

I grabbed the bottle and another glass.

“You’re scared p>

I paused.

“I get it, okay? Because I am too p>

I resumed what I was doing, filling up my glass.

“But that doesn’t mean we can’t… Catherine isn’t that witch; her loving you doesn’t mean it would be like p>

“I don’t need her love p>

“I love you, does that count as what you don’t need p>

“You’re my sister.” I sipped the alcohol.

“Ares p>

“Love is for someone capable of returning it I glanced her way. “I saw her eyes, she wants love, and I don’t. We can’t work that way if what we want are two different things p>

“Tell me right now… say it to my face that you don’t feel anything, even a little p>

I gulped thickly as I looked away. “I don’t. It was never part of the equation p>

“You don’t mean that p>

“And you? You think I don’t know about Isaac’s advances and how you keep pushing him away p>

“We’re not talking about me, but you p>

“Both. No matter how we try… we can’t, and you know it p>

She took the bottle and refilled her glass. “You’re right. We’re too broken for anything good. We’re the worst ones. You know, I always wonder how we would have turned out if Mom were still alive. I dreamed of it once, and it was beautiful p>

Athena smiled. “Of course that personality of yours would never change, but… It’s times like this I wish that dream came through, maybe everything would have been good p>

“I’ll hate you for this, Ares… I will p>

“I know p>

She eyed my hand wrapped in a bandage, but she didn’t say anything about it.

“Boss!” Nico came into view. “I have been trying to reach you p>

“I don’t want to be disturbed p>

“It’s about your stepmother; she met with your wife p>

“How come you’re just saying this now?!” Athena yelled.

I set my glass down, feeling my blood boil. “What happened p>

“They talked, but I don’t know what p>

I pushed to my feet, and Nico backed away a little bit when he saw I wasn’t in a good mood.

“Talked,” I said with venom in my tone, because I knew damn well it couldn’t have been just that.

“Ares… We don’t know what that witch told her, but it can’t be good p>

I inhaled, grabbed my jacket, and walked out.

“Ares p>

“Keep her here, Nico,” I said as I went out the door.

“What? Don’t touch me. Ares p>

I walked down the stairs, held my phone, and dialed her number.

“I warned you!” I hissed the moment she answered.

“Ares Agatha said softly. “You don’t sound okay p>

“Why p>

“Why what p>

When I said nothing, she sighed.

“I heard the news, and I went to see Catherine, that’s all. What else could there be p>

“Don’t toy with me p>

“Are you worried I might have said something to her p>

I clenched my phone so hard it felt like it would shatter into pieces.

“Are you scared, sweetheart p>

Rage crawled through me, and I ended the call.

I made my way back to the penthouse, speeding through the road.

I came to an abrupt stop, the tires screeching. I got out, heading straight for the elevator, punching the password. When I was inside, I didn’t stop until I found myself at Catherine’s door.

It opened as Catherine was about to step out. Seeing me, she took a step back, her eyes were puffy and red, her nose too. A part of me felt like peeling my skin off for reducing her to such a state, but the moment I thought about the encounter she had with Agatha, I felt rage.

“What did Agatha say to you p>

“What do you mean p>

“Don’t I walked in. “Lie p>

She grew angry. “What did you think she told me p>

“Don’t turn this around p>

“What does it even matter?” She exploded in my face.

My breath hitched, but I got distracted when I saw her bags were packed. Seeing everything trapped in that box made a twisted feeling grip me.

“I gave you a month p>

“I don’t need a month p>

I veered my eyes to her; she did her best to hold it even though it seemed like she would blink away any minute.

I walked forward, and she took one back, trying to ward me off, but I trapped her against the wall, pressing my hand above her head.

My insides were roaring, my brain felt like splitting apart, and everything was clashing so fast I could hear my blood veins pumping in my eardrums, but when I looked into those hazels, I found silence.

I couldn’t stop myself from kissing her, but she pushed me off with every strength she had and slapped me across the cheek.

“I’m not yours to touch anymore. Get out p>

I didn’t move, so she shoved me against my chest. “GET OUT p>

Catherine tossed things at me, anything she could find, screaming at me from the top of her lungs.

I barely made it out the door before she slammed it in my face.
